Whether you love melee or ranged combat, you need to make sure you know your Class and Race matchups for optimal efficiency since you can't gain too many Ability Points after creating your character. Your character sheet lets you map out who you are in the game, which skills you have, and how you can use them to suit your chosen gameplay style. Then you'll be fleshing out your starting Skills, which are largely influenced by your race. You'll be investing six total points into six Ability areas, namely Strength, Wisdom, Dexterity, Constitution, Intelligence, and Charisma. The foundation of combat in Baldur's Gate 3 is your build, and creating a strong build is a fine balancing act.
